In addition to the lake itself, the Lake Rådasjö nature preserve includes country environments, shore woods, open pastures and temperate broad-leaf stands dominated by oak. The whole area around the Råda Manor is a well-preserved example of west-Swedish upper-class settings. Together with the nearby Gunnebo Manor it creates a very valuable biological and cultural whole. There are several valuable nature types in the preserve no longer widely spread in Sweden.
There is a 12 kilometer marked trail around the lake. Most of it is in the form of gravel paths running through the broad-leaf stands near the lake. Some parts are asphalted promenade and bicycle roads or through housing areas. A start sign and an overall map are found at the Råda Manor and at some other sites.
